LEGAL OPINION

Thank you for your September 30, 2024, letter requesting my opinion regarding the appropriate school district taxing authority for property located adjacent to the Grand Forks Air Force Base and leased to a private entity. Pursuant to N.D.C.C. § 57-15-13, a school district only has taxing authority over property located within the boundaries of the school district, and determining which school district the property is located in is a question of fact. This office, "is limited to dealing with questions oflaw and is not authorized to resolve factual disputes of any nature[.]"

In summary, the Property leased by Grand Sky has an exception that allows for taxation to be levied upon the lessee by the State and local governments. The authority of a school district to levy taxes does not extend beyond the boundaries of the school district. The boundaries of a military installation school district are established by N.D.C.C. § 15.1-18-01(3), however, whether the Property satisfies those requirements depends on the facts, which will be determined through the local jurisdiction's fact-finding process.
